Re: Driver station problem

Quote:
Originally Posted by team2491 View Post
We pinged everything, and everything but the driver station itself responded; after a couple hours of deliberation, we have come for help. Our driver station appears to be working fine, but it's displaying Battery: No comms and isn't talking to either our driver station router or the computer itself. Haven't gotten a ping returned from it under any conditions since yesterday. Thanks!
Can you try connecting the ethernet cable from the computer to the other Driver Station ethernet port, and see if a ping succeeds? Maybe one (or both?) of the ports on the DS has fallen victim to a static electricity event.

Also, make sure the team number is set properly on the DS. I hate to suggest voodoo solutions, but it might be worth trying to set the team number again even if it shows correctly on the display.
